CHICAGO, June 22, 2015 /PRNewswire/ -- DTZ, a global leader in commercial real estate services, announced today that the firm has been honored as a member of IDG's CIO magazine's 2015 CIO 100. The 28th annual awards program recognizes organizations around the world that exemplify the highest level of operational and strategic excellence in information technology (IT).
"For 28 years now, the CIO 100 awards have honored the innovative use of technology to deliver genuine business value," said Maryfran Johnson, Editor in Chief of CIO magazine & events. "Our 2015 winners are an outstanding example of the transformative power of IT to drive everything from revenue growth to competitive advantage."
Executives from the winning companies will be recognized at The CIO 100 Symposium & Awards Ceremony to be held Tuesday, August 11, at The Broadmoor in Colorado Springs, CO.
Recipients of this year's CIO 100 Award were selected through a three-step process. First, companies filled out an online application detailing their innovative IT and business initiatives. Next, a team of external judges, many of them former CIOs, reviewed the applications in depth, looking for leading-edge IT practices and measurable results. Finally, CIO editors reviewed the judges' recommendations and selected the final 100.

About DTZ
DTZ is a global leader in commercial real estate services providing occupiers, tenants and investors around the world with a full spectrum of property solutions. The company's core capabilities include agency leasing, tenant representation, corporate and global occupier services, property management, facilities management, facility services, capital markets, investment and asset management, valuation, research, consulting, and project and development management. DTZ provides property management for 1.9 billion square feet, or 171 million square meters, and facilities management for 1.3 billion square feet, or 124 million square meters. The company completed $63 billion in transaction volume globally in 2014 on behalf of institutional, corporate, government and private clients. Headquartered in Chicago, DTZ has more than 28,000 employees who operate across more than 260 offices in 50 countries and represent the company's culture of excellence, client advocacy, integrity and collaboration.
DTZ announced an agreement to merge with Cushman & Wakefield in a May 11 press release. The new company, which will operate under the Cushman & Wakefield brand, will have revenues over $5.5 billion, over 43,000 employees and will manage more than 4 billion square feet globally on behalf of institutional, corporate and private clients.
